With another Cascade... Cold helped for stability but didn't give BCLK improvement.

Latest beta BIOS helps with cold-boot, which has decreased from -40C to about -55C now. This makes reboots a bit less boring.

Furthermore, altought the CPU was cold-bugged at -105C with original BIOS, it now runs less than -110C without problem. Very tempting for the 3-stager...

No need to turn HT off. Amazing motherboard! :

I need 400ps CPU skew to stay any kind of pi stable past 221 bclock, and it generally does better when the IOH skew is set to match.

This is max validation so far with the G25 BIOS using 500ps skews on water:

Attachment 110274

Increasing QPI latencies to 100-150 helps stability.

I don't know if freezing will help with the new bclock wall on bloodrage until they give another BIOS update allowing PCIe frequency greater than 102. I'll find out after my Duniek pot arrives.
